Flavor & Texture Profile
The cookie presents a multi-tiered tasting profile: caramelized-sugar sweetness, buttered richness, intermittent savory-salty highlights, and a final, lingering toasted note. On first bite, the palate registers a warm sweetness that is rounded by a buttery backbone; the perception of fat contributes to a coating sensation that prolongs flavor release. The central chew should be tender and moist, offering slight resistance before yielding — a sensation produced when moisture and fat are balanced to prevent a dry crumb. The edges develop a delicate, brittle sheen where sugars have caramelized, providing a satisfying contrast. Interspersed within this matrix are mix-ins that provide intermittent bursts: small morsels that shatter, little caramel flecks that smear and dissolve, and softened dried fruit that offers a concentrated tartness to offset the surrounding sweetness. Texturally, the goal is heterogeneity: no single mouthfeel should dominate. When constructing the dough, attention to particle size is essential; larger pieces contribute pronounced crunch but can disrupt shaping, while finely chopped additions integrate more seamlessly and affect spread differently. Temperature also plays a role: slightly chilled dough will produce thicker domes and a chewier interior, whereas warmer dough yields wider, crisper cookies. The olfactory profile evolves from buttery and toasty notes to the warm cocoa and caramel aromatics as the cookie cools, making each stage of consumption distinct.

Preparation Overview
The successful execution rests on three pillars: controlled aeration, judicious incorporation of inclusions, and thermal management of the dough. In culinary terms, the first pillar — controlled aeration — is achieved by creating a batter that traps sufficient air for lift without introducing so much that the structure becomes fragile. This is accomplished by a brief, efficient creaming stage and careful attention to mixing speed and duration. The second pillar concerns inclusion management: mix-ins must be distributed to achieve regularity without overworking the matrix; folding techniques that use gravity and tactical strokes protect both the distribution and gluten development. The third pillar, thermal management, addresses dough temperature before and during baking. Temperature determines spread, caramelization rate and crumb hydration. For example, slightly chilled dough reduces horizontal spread, concentrating caramelization at the rim and preserving interior moisture. Conversely, warm dough accentuates edge crispness. Tools and technique streamline this process: a sturdy mixing implement for initial aeration, a flexible spatula for folding, and portioning tools to create uniform shapes so that bake profiles are consistent across the tray. Attention to particle size of inclusions, and their moisture or fat content, will influence dispersion and the final mouthfeel. Cooking / Assembly Process
Assembly and thermal orchestration transform the dough into cookies with complex texture: aim for even distribution, controlled rise and accentuated edge caramelization. Begin by forming uniform portions to ensure consistent heat exposure; uniformity is the most reliable way to achieve homogeneous texture across multiple cookies. Use a gentle but decisive folding motion to integrate inclusions so they remain suspended rather than concentrating in pockets. When arranging dough portions on the baking surface, leave sufficient space for heat-driven expansion and place a few extra pieces conspicuously on top to emphasize the rustic, studded appearance post-bake. During the baking interval, thermal gradients develop from the pan edges inward; this gradient is what creates a firm rim and a yielding center. For more precise control over margin texture, consider rotating trays midway and using baking surfaces that promote desired conduction: darker pans encourage faster coloration, while lighter, insulating surfaces slow browning and favor a chewier result. Remove items from heat when the centers still appear slightly underdone; carryover residual heat will finish the set while preserving moisture. After extraction, short rest on the warm surface allows the structure to stabilize before transferring to a cooling rack, preventing undue collapse.
- Portion uniformly with a scoop for consistent domes and bake performance.
- Fold inclusions in the final mixing stage to maintain dough integrity.
- Choose baking surfaces intentionally to tune coloration and crispness.

Storage & Make-Ahead Tips
Preserve texture and flavor by controlling moisture migration and by selecting appropriate storage atmospheres for short- and long-term holding. For short-term storage at room temperature, an airtight container with a single dry layer will preserve the cookie’s intended contrast between chewy interior and crisp edges for a few days; include a paper towel to moderate surface humidity if the environment is humid. When stacking for storage, place parchment or wax paper between layers to prevent surface abrasion and the translocation of sticky inclusions. For longer-term preservation, flash-freeze individual portions on a tray until firm, then transfer to a sealed, low-oxygen container; this approach minimizes deformation and enables single-portion retrieval. Thaw frozen cookies at room temperature or use a low-heat refresh to re-mobilize melted components. If crispness has been lost, a short, low-temperature bake on a wire rack can rejuvenate the edges without over-drying the center; test with a single cookie before reheating an entire batch. Avoid refrigerating baked cookies for storage as condensation during return to room temperature can cause undesirable softening and textural homogenization unless tightly sealed and stabilized. For pre-bake make-ahead, portion dough onto trays and freeze until firm, then collect into a container; frozen portions can be baked directly from frozen with only modest extension of time, preserving the balance between spread and interior set.
- Short-term: airtight container at room temperature with a paper towel to control humidity.
- Long-term: flash-freeze single portions then transfer to sealed bags to prevent deformation.
- Refresh: gentle low-heat reheat or brief low-temperature bake to restore texture.
Frequently Asked Questions
Answers to common technical and service questions to help maintain quality and troubleshoot common issues without altering the original recipe. Why do my cookies spread too much? Excessive spread is typically the result of either over-softened fat, insufficiently floured contact surfaces, or dough being too warm at the moment it meets heat. Chilling portions briefly before introducing them to intense heat will reduce lateral spread and produce a thicker profile. How can I keep edges crisp while preserving a chewy center? This balance is a function of thermal gradient and bake termination: allow edges to develop color while removing cookies while the interior remains slightly under-set so residual carryover finishes the center. Choice of bake surface can also promote desired coloration. What is the best way to incorporate many different mix-ins without creating pockets? Final-stage folding and portioning by scoop reduce the likelihood of concentration. Distribute mix-ins proportionally in separate bowls if necessary, then fold them in gently to achieve even dispersion. Can I scale the recipe up for a large event? Yes; maintain proportion, mix in batches to avoid overworking dough, and use uniform portioning tools to ensure consistent bakes. When producing large quantities, stagger sheet trays in the oven to allow movement of hot air and rotate as needed for even coloration. How should I handle substitutions for allergies or preferences? Replace problematic inclusions with texturally analogous items rather than trying to replicate flavor alone; for example, substitute toasted seeds for nuts to preserve crunch, or small fruit pieces for larger dried fruit to retain moisture balance. Kitchen Sink Cookies
Meet the ultimate crowd-pleaser: Kitchen Sink Cookies 🍪 — chewy, crunchy and loaded with every tasty mix-in you love. Perfect for parties or when you can't decide what to bake!

ingredients
- 2 1/4 cups all-purpose flour 🌾
- 1 tsp baking soda 🧂
- 1/2 tsp fine salt 🧂
- 1 cup (227g) unsalted butter, softened 🧈
- 3/4 cup packed brown sugar 🟤
- 1/2 cup granulated sugar 🍬
- 2 large eggs 🥚
- 2 tsp vanilla extract 🌿
- 1 cup old-fashioned oats 🥣
- 1 cup semisweet chocolate chips 🍫
- 1/2 cup white chocolate chips 🤍
- 1/2 cup chopped pecans or walnuts 🌰
- 1/2 cup dried cranberries or raisins 🍒
- 1/2 cup pretzel pieces 🥨
- 1/2 cup toffee bits or chopped caramel 🍯
- 1/3 cup shredded coconut (optional) 🥥
instructions
- Preheat oven to 350°F (175°C). Line two baking sheets with parchment paper.
- In a medium bowl, whisk together the flour, baking soda and salt until evenly combined.
- In a large bowl or stand mixer, cream the softened butter with brown sugar and granulated sugar until light and fluffy, about 2–3 minutes.
- Add the eggs one at a time, mixing well after each, then stir in the vanilla extract.
- Mix in the oats until just combined.
- Fold the dry flour mixture into the wet ingredients in two additions, mixing until just combined—don’t overmix.
- Stir in all the mix-ins: chocolate chips, white chips, nuts, dried fruit, pretzels, toffee bits and coconut (if using) until evenly distributed. The dough should be chunky and full of mix-ins.
- Scoop rounded tablespoons (or use a 1.5 tbsp cookie scoop) of dough onto the prepared sheets, spacing cookies about 2 inches apart. Press a few extra mix-ins onto the tops for a rustic look.
- Bake for 10–13 minutes, until edges are set and centers are still slightly soft. Rotate pans halfway through baking for even color.
- Let cookies cool on the baking sheet for 5 minutes, then transfer to a wire rack to cool completely.
- Store in an airtight container at room temperature for up to 4 days, or freeze for longer storage.
